Sedalia Man Injured in Pettis County Vehicle Wreck
A 27-year old Sedalia man was injured Friday morning in a Pettis County vehicle wreck.
The Missouri State Highway Patrol reported the accident at 6:45, at Route U and Anderson School Road.
According to the online crash report, a 2017 Nissan failed to negotiate a curve, traveled off the road, then struck a driveway and a tree before coming to rest.
The driver, 27-year old Jeramy R. Ross, suffered minor injuries. He was wearing a safety device.
Ross was taken to Bothwell Regional Health Center for treatment.
The Nissan sustained extensive damage and towed by Inmotion Tow.
